+  adi,clk_rcvr_125_en:
No underscores in node names
quoted
+    description: |
+      Set GE_CLK_RCVR_125_EN (bit 5 of GE_CLK_CFG), causing the 125 MHz
+      PHY recovered clock (or PLL clock) to be driven at the GP_CLK pin.
You are describing programming model but you should describe rather
hardware feature instead. This should be reflected in property name and
description. Focus on hardware and describe it.
